Singer Kurt Elling is a phenomenon. New York Times describes him as ‘the standout male vocalist of our time’ and he has topped the Downbeat polls for ten years in a row. Elling sings standards, recites poetry and vocalises bebop solos and distinguished jazz melodies. On his recent CD The Gate he sings jazz compositions alongside soul and rock by, amongst others, Stevie Wonder, Joe Jackson and King Crimson. ‘One of the few post-Baby Boom hardcore jazz artists who can live up to the term “original”’ (Downbeat).
